/****** site design and hosting by www.estesCreative.com  ******/

body {
background-color:#ffffff;
background-image:url(images/bg.gif);
background-position:top;
background-repeat:repeat-x;
margin: 0px 0px 0px 0px;
font-family: Verdana, Arial, Helvetica, sans-serif;
font-size:11px;
}
a {
color: #36f;
}
a:hover {
color: #69f;
}
h1 {
color: #666666;
font-family:Arial, Helvetica, sans-serif;
font-weight:bold;
font-size:21px;
line-height:24px;
}
h2 {
color: #2A70AE;
font-family:Arial, Helvetica, sans-serif;
font-size:13px;
line-height:20px;
font-weight:bold
padding:0px 0px 0px 0px;
margin:0px 0px 12px 0px;
}
h3 {
color: #4D4D4D;
font-family:Arial, Helvetica, sans-serif;
font-size:13px;
line-height:15px;
font-weight:bold
}
.blueText {
color: #2A70AE;
font-weight:bold;
font-size: 19px;
}
.blueTextSmall {
color: #2A70AE;
font-weight:bold;
font-size: 11px;
}
.blueTextThin {
color: #2A70AE;
}
.blueBGform {
background-color:#E5E7EE;
}

/****** divs ******/

div.table {
width:740px;
text-align:left;
}
div.logo {
height:156px;
width:239px;
float:left;
}
div.header {
height:156px;
width:501px;
float:left;
}
div.breadcrumbs {
color:#cccccc;
padding: 10px 5px 5px 5px;
float:right;
font-size:11px;
font-family:Verdana, Arial, Helvetica, sans-serif;
}
div.breadcrumbs a{
color:#cccccc;
text-decoration:none;
}
div.breadcrumbs a:hover{
color:#cccccc;
text-decoration:underline;
}
#headerButtons {
height:128px;
width:550px;
position:absolute;
top:50px;
z-index:2;
}
div.news {
background-color:#4D4D4D;
width:194px;
height:188px;
float:left;
padding:20px 20px 20px 25px;
line-height:13px;
color:#FFFFFF;
}
div.news a{
color:#cccccc;
text-decoration:none;
font-weight: normal;
}
div.news a:hover{
color:#cccccc;
text-decoration:underline;
font-weight: normal;
}
div.flash {
width:500px;
height:133px;
float:left;
margin-top:22px;
position:relative;
}
div.nonFlash {
width:500px;
height:133px;
float:left;
margin-top:22px;
}
div.subNav {
background-color:#4D4D4D;
width:194px;
height:133px;
float:left;
padding:11px 20px 11px 25px;
line-height:13px;
color:#FFFFFF;
}
div.subNav a{
color:#cccccc;
text-decoration:none;
}
div.subNav a:hover{
color:#cccccc;
text-decoration:underline;
}
div.bodyBG {
width:739px;
height:100%;
background-color:#C4C399;
float:left;
}
div.sideBar {
background-color:#C4C399;
color:#4D4D4D;
line-height:14px;
width:194px;
float:left;
padding:23px 20px 30px 25px;
}
.pullQuote {
color:#4D4D4D;
line-height:25px;
}
div.bodyTop {
background-color:#EFF0F4;
width:460px;
height:100%;
float:left;
padding:20px 20px 25px 20px;
line-height:15px;
border-bottom:1px solid #cccccc;
text-align:justify;
}
div.bodyTop2 {
background-color:#EFF0F4;
width:460px;
height:100%;
padding:20px 20px 25px 20px;
margin-top:22px;
line-height:15px;
border-bottom:1px solid #cccccc;
float:right;
text-align:justify;
}
.picBorder {
border: 3px solid #D2D7EA;
margin: 0px 30px 0px 0px;
padding:2px;
}
.mapBorder {
border: 3px solid #D2D7EA;
padding:2px;
}
div.bodyBottom {
background-color:#ffffff;
width:500px;
float:right;
text-align:justify;
}
div.left {
width:210px;
float:left;
padding:5px 8px 5px 20px;
margin:20px 0px 20px 0px;
}
div.right {
width:209px;
float:right;
border-left:1px solid #cccccc;
padding:5px 8px 5px 20px;
margin:20px 0px 20px 0px;
}
div.full{
width:460px;
float:right;
padding:5px 20px 5px 20px;
margin:20px 0px 20px 0px;
}
.titleUnderline {
border-bottom:1px solid #cccccc;
padding:0px 0px 15px 0px;
}
.titleSpace {
padding:0px 0px 15px 0px;
}
/******** menu ***********/

ul {
list-style: none;
padding: 0;
margin: 0;
}
#nav a {
text-decoration: none;
}
#nav img {
border:0px;
}
#nav li li a {
display: block;
font-weight: normal;
color: #1A5688;
padding:5px 7px 5px 20px;
}
#nav li li a:hover {
padding:5px 7px 5px 15px;
border: 5px solid #4D4D4D;
border-width: 0 5px;
color:#4D4D4D;
}
li {
float: left;
width:125px;
position: relative;
text-align: left;
}
li ul {
display: none;
position: absolute;
top: 100%;
left: 0;
z-index:auto;
font-weight: normal;
background: url(images/trans.png);
border-bottom: 5px solid #527FA5;
}
li>ul {
top: auto;
left: auto;
}
li li {
display: block;
float: none;
background-color: transparent;
border: 0;
}
li:hover ul, li.over ul {
display: block;
}
hr {
display: none;
}

#id{
	position:absolute;
	z-index:1;
}

/******** footer *********/
div.one {
width:194px;
float:left;
position:relative;
}
div.footer {
height:27px;
width:739px;
background-image:url(images/firefoxBugFix.gif);
background-repeat:repeat-y;
margin:0px 0px 10px 0px;
float:left
}
div.copyright {
width:550px;
height:75px;
text-align:left;
color:#666666;
float:left;
line-height:15px;
}
div.estesCreative {
float: right;
font-weight:bold;
text-align:right;
font-size:10px;
color:#333333;
}